molded EVA foam parts
// The softest foam we work with, and the one that stretches furthest — over 200% elongation. Choose EVA where the foam has to hug a curved surface, seal a gap, or be squeezed thousands of times and still recover: gaskets, liners, hand-contact surfaces, sports and medical parts. Water absorption stays under 1%.
Property comparison· click a grade to highlight
| Property | EV30 | EV50 | Test method |
|---|---|---|---|
| Nominal density (g/L) | 30 | 50 | ISO 7214:2012 |
| Average cell diameter (mm) | 0.4 | 0.4 | — |
| Compression stress (kPa) | ISO 7214:2012 | ||
| @ 25% strain | 39 | 50 | |
| @ 50% strain | 100 | 116 | |
| Tensile strength (kPa) | 520 | 749 | ISO 7214:2012 |
| Elongation at break (%) | 205 | 243 | ISO 7214:2012 |
| Compression set, 50% / 22 h (%) | ISO 7214:2012 | ||
| after 0.5 h recovery | 13 | 9 | |
| after 24 h recovery | 4 | 2 | |
| Tear strength (kN/m) | 1.675 | 2.880 | ISO 8067 Method B |
| Hardness (Shore OO) | 40 | 46 | ISO 868:2003 |
| Recommended max service temp (°C) | 65 | 65 | — |
| Water absorption (%) | <1 | <1 | ISO 2896:2001 |
Grade selection guide
Conforming liners · soft-touch surfaces · light sealing
EV30 · 30 g/L39 kPa @25% · Shore OO 40The softer of the two — it takes the shape of what it wraps.
Repeated-use gaskets · straps · load-bearing pads
EV50 · 50 g/L50 kPa @25% · 2.880 kN/m tearStronger, tougher, and recovers to within 2% after 24 h.
// Different structures, different test standards — read this as a shortlist aid, not a like-for-like ranking. Tell us the load, temperature and handling your part sees, and we will narrow it down with you.
| Property | EPP | EPO | E-PE | EVA |
|---|---|---|---|---|
| Structure | Molded PP bead foam | PS/polyolefin composite bead foam | Molded PE bead foam | Cross-linked closed-cell EVA |
| Density range | 20–66 kg/m³ | 16–33 g/L | 20–74 g/L | 30–50 g/L |
| Compression stress @25% | 80–395 kPa | 120–190 kPa | 60.7–296.5 kPa | 39–50 kPa |
| Tensile strength | 420–1350 kPa | 0.28–0.53 MPa | 275.8–827.4 kPa | 520–749 kPa |
| Elongation at break | ≥15% | 7.6–9.7% | 22–38% | 205–243% |
| Thermal conductivity | ≈0.036–0.042 W/(m·K) | 0.037–0.039 W/(m·K) | 0.0346–0.0433 W/(m·K) | not published |
| Service temperature | ≈ up to 100°C | 80°C automotive evaluation¹ | max 80°C | max 65°C recommended |
| Water absorption | ≤8% | not published | <5 vol.% | <1% |
| Character | Tough, resilient, reusable — the workhorse | Stiffer support with impact resistance | Flexible, water-resistant, widest density span | Soft, high elongation, conforms and rebounds |
